#b1595c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#b1595c is composed of 69.4% red, 34.9% green and 36.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 49.7% magenta, 48% yellow and 30.6% black. It has a hue angle of 358 degrees, a saturation of 36.1% and a lightness of 52.2%. #b1595c color hex could be obtained by blending #ffb2b8 with #630000. Closest websafe color is: #996666.

● #b1595c color description : Dark moderate red.
#b1595c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#b1595c has RGB values of R:177, G:89, B:92 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.5, Y:0.48, K:0.31. Its decimal value is 11622748.

Shades and Tints of #b1595c
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070404 is the darkest color, while #fcf9f9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#b1595c
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#8b7f7f is the less saturated color, while #fc0e16 is the most saturated one.
